Ceramic membranes are characterized by an exceptionally long service life. Unlike polymeric membranes, they are extremely robust against chemical, mechanical, and thermal stresses. The ceramic membrane material is inert and therefore does not react with most chemicals used in industrial processes. High temperatures and intensive cleaning cycles also pose no problem for the membranes.
In standard applications (e.g., degreasing baths and rinsing baths), ceramic membranes are therefore usually not considered wear parts. Provided that the membranes are operated within their design limits and no mechanical damage occurs, they can be reliably used for many years. The actual achievable service life depends on the specific application, operating conditions, and type of cleaning. However, in many industrial plants, ceramic membranes are in use many times longer than comparable membranes made of polymeric materials. The cost savings in plant maintenance due to the elimination of regular membrane changes are enormous.
